Eyelash serum made of 90% natural ingredients. The formula makes eyelashes stronger and longer, providing visible results after 4 weeks of continued use.
Subtotal: $921.98
Subtotal: $921.98
Eyelash serum made of 90% natural ingredients. The formula makes eyelashes stronger and longer, providing visible results after 4 weeks of continued use.